with poplar secondary wood. Upper case dovetailed, with moulded breadboard lid, and interior lidded till. Lower case with 2 thumb-moulded drawers with inlaid escutcheons, and sitting on bracket feet. Retains its original hinges and locks (lid hasp off but present), period Hepplewhite brasses, and a fine, old finish. American, late 18th or early 19th century; 32.35" high x 50" wide x 24.25" deep. > From the Estate of John Auraden of Hamilton & Fairhaven, Ohio. > Condition: As above, with small age crack to the lid, backboard warped causing minor separation to upper dovetails, castors are a later addition; still VG.
